House of Hamill to Perform at Riverside Rhythm & Rhyme Songwriter Series

originally published: 04/03/2018

House of Hamill to Perform at Riverside Rhythm & Rhyme Songwriter Series(SUCCASUNNA, NJ) – On Sunday, April 29, 2018, from 4:00pm - 6:00pm, the Riverside Rhythm and Rhyme (RR&R) songwriter series presents the Celtic duo, House of Hamill, atThe Investors Bank Theatre at RoxPAC, 72 Eyland Avenue, Succasunna, NJ.

House of Hamill, the dynamic fiddling duo of Rose Baldino (Burning Bridget Cleary) & Brian Buchanan (Enter the Haggis) will headline the show.  Both Baldino and Buchanan are accomplished traditional fiddle players as well as classical violinists, with over 25 years of writing and performance experience between them. Together, they write unusual new fiddle tunes and exciting, unpredictable original songs while breathing new life into traditional and contemporary songs. Confident and unique lead vocalists, the blend of their two voices in harmony is hypnotic and irresistible.

Whether House of Hamill is playing songs from their debut album "Wide Awake" (September 2016) or stomping through a set of original jigs and reels, their chemistry onstage is always engaging and often hilarious. You'll leave with tired feet, a huge smile, and a new appreciation for the versatility of folk instruments in a modern context. House of Hamill is on the bleeding edge of a new generation of traditional musicians.

RoxPAC is a great local venue which can accommodate about 150 patrons, offers ample parking and is conveniently accessible from Routes 80, 46 and 10. Furnished with comfortable padded seating, great acoustics and theatre lighting, there is not a bad seat in the house! Concert goers will have plenty of time after the performance to enjoy dinner out at any number of local food establishments in town.

Riverside Rhythm and Rhyme is an eclectic coffee house/listening room style venue in the heart of Roxbury Township showcasing local and regional independent artists. This monthly outreach performance songwriter series is presented by the Skylands Songwriters Guild (SSG) in cooperation with the Roxbury Arts Alliance (RAA) and is an "XPN Welcomes" event.

Skylands Songwriters Guild, based out of Ledgewood, NJ, is a recognized 501(c)(3) educational non-profit organization dedicated to cultivating the Singer-Songwriter community of Northwest New Jersey and surrounding region. Donations are tax deductible.
